Output d5d87362e858653a371aaf0ed538de80d56853aa129969df9cb597a7cada2607:5

value
572110000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 637b41892200c53ad620b52ab14bd665d4eee567 OP_EQUAL
address
3Am2UWeGGvghtiWzt6wqLYCVmBSrbu4CJh
transaction
d5d87362e858653a371aaf0ed538de80d56853aa129969df9cb597a7cada2607
spent
true